Urban Development Pressures

Urban development pressures loom large over Alfalah Street. As Dubai expands, the demand for real estate and commercial spaces continues to skyrocket. Older structures often find themselves at risk of being replaced or renovated to meet modern standards. This, however, can be a double-edged sword.

On one hand, increasing development can attract investors and boost local economies. On the other, the character of the area may suffer if historical significance isn’t preserved. Large-scale redevelopment can lead to gentrification, pushing out long-term residents or changing the local culture drastically. The balance between maintaining historical landmarks and allowing contemporary growth is delicate, and failure to navigate it could tarnish Alfalah’s unique charm.

Moreover, the surge of construction projects raises questions about infrastructure capacity. With more buildings, there’s a crucial need for upgrades in roads, public transportation, and utility services. Traffic congestion may exacerbate as new developments attract larger populations, making it difficult for current residents to maintain their quality of life.

Socio-Economic Factors

The socio-economic landscape of Alfalah Street is equally complex. Variations in income levels among residents lead to different housing needs and consumer behaviors. For instance, with a mix of expats and locals, demand can range from luxury apartments to affordable housing. Developers must make informed decisions regarding what kind of properties to build to ensure they meet the needs of a diverse demographic.

Furthermore, economic fluctuations can impact investment opportunities. For example, a dip in the global economy can deter foreign investments, which have traditionally underpinned much of Dubai's real estate growth. Investors and real estate agents need to stay attuned to economic indicators to better predict shifts in the market.

"Understanding the socio-economic conditions helps investors navigate the complex landscape of real estate in Alfalah Street; without this insight, one risks misreading the market."

Rising living costs can also pressure local businesses. If residents face financial strain, discretionary spending on dining or entertainment might plummet, directly impacting those business owners. This often leads to a cycle where businesses close, jobs are lost, and the overall vibrancy of the area diminishes.

Real Estate Regulations

Navigating the maze of real estate regulations is not for the faint of heart, especially in a market as dynamic as Dubai's. The rules governing Alfalah Street extend from property registration to prohibitions on certain types of developments. Here are some key aspects:

  • Property Registration: Any buyer must ensure their property is duly registered with the Dubai Land Department; otherwise, they risk legal complications later.
  • Zoning Laws: Particular areas along Alfalah Street may have restrictions dictating what kind of developments can occur, affecting everything from height limitations to overall land use.
  • Tenant Rights: Regulatory guidelines also protect tenant rights, providing frameworks that landlords must follow in terms of leases, evictions, and rent increases.

Failure to comply with these regulations can result in fines and, at worst, project halts. For potential investors or residents, understanding these nuances is vital. The landscape is changing, and remaining in the know will ensure that one is not caught off-guard by sudden regulatory shifts.
